Cagiva 500 River

 

 

 

 

Make Model

Cagiva 500 River---

Year

200

Engine

Single cylinder. air/oil cooled. four stroke, 4 valves per cylinder

Capacity

497
Bore x Stroke 92.8 x 73.6 mm
Compression Ratio

Induction

40mm Mikuni carb

Ignition  /  Starting

-  /  electric

Max Power

34 hp @ 6000 rpm

Max Torque

4.5 kg-m @ 4750 rpm

Transmission  /  Drive

5 Speed  /  chain

Front Suspension

40mm Marzocchi forks, 150mm wheel travel

Rear Suspension

Boge monoshock, preload adjustable, 140mm wheel travel

Front Brakes

Single 320 mm disc 4 piston caliper

Rear Brakes

Single 230mm disc

Front Tyre

110/80-17

Rear Tyre

140/70-17

Dry-Weight

160 kg

Fuel Capacity

18 Litres

A rather rare machine from Italian manufacturer Cagiva, the River is a simple, unassuming commuter machine with some pleasing design touches. Powered by an elderly single-cylinder air-cooled engine, the River's moderate power and economical running makes it ideal for commuting. The River is also cheap to insure and eligible for the limited Al licence class in Europe. The chassis is rather higher-spec, with a twin-spar frame, upside-down forks and monoshock rear, while Brembo disc brakes front and rear ensure trouble-free stopping. A small screen and stylish sculpted fuel tank increase the River's appeal, and it coiild also be supplied with factory-approved hard luggage panniers, further enhancing its commuter role.
